(Title 31) § 31-5-923: The lights need not be displayed by a vehicle parked lawfully in an urban district, or stopped lawfully to receive or discharge passengers, or stopped to avoid conflict with other traffic or to comply with the directions of a police officer or an official traffic-control device or while the devices
What this law says, in plain English
Drivers of certain vehicles stopped or disabled outside urban areas for over 10 minutes must display warning devices (flares, lanterns, or reflectors) at specific distances to alert approaching traffic.
